兔脑炎原虫引起肾上皮凋亡的研究

摘    要:对 16只具有兔脑炎原虫病的示病症状 ,即出现不同程度的头颈歪邪、震颤、平衡失调和转圈运动等运动障碍症状的獭兔 ,运用原位末端标记技术和基因染色技术 ,着重对病兔肾组织损伤的发生进行了研究。结果表明 :肾远曲小管和集合管是脑炎原虫主要的寄生部位 ,在此常能检出虫体或假囊 ;凋亡的细胞多见于集合小管的上皮细胞。用TUNEL染色 ,不同阶段的凋亡细胞可出现不同的病理形态学变化。初期的凋亡细胞 ,其胞核浓缩 ,胞膜增厚 ,着色较均匀 ;后期的凋亡细胞 ,其胞核的体积明显变小 ,胞浆减少 ,胞膜呈皱襞状 ,紧紧地包绕着皱缩而浓染的细胞核 ,形成典型的凋亡小体。用 P53和 Bcl- 2染色 ,由于基因表达产物的扩散 ,不仅受损细胞的核染色较深 ,而且胞浆染色也较深。研究证明 ,TUNEL 染色是一种检测由脑炎原虫引起肾细胞凋亡的灵敏、可靠的方法 ;P53和 Bcl- 2基因参与了肾细胞的凋亡过程 ;临床上病兔多尿与脱水可能主要与肾远曲小管和集合管的上皮细胞凋亡有关。

Renal Epithelium Apoptosis Caused by Encephalitozoon Cuniculi

Abstract:Sixteen otter rabbits suffering from encephalitozoonosis,that occurred with the symptoms of wry neck,tremor,dysequilibrium and turning circle,were used in this experiment.The injury changes of renal tissues were mainly studied with staining technique of in situ terminal labeling and genes.The results manifested that the parasitism sites of protozoa were mainly in distal convoluted renal tubule and collecting duct.Protozoa or psudo-cysts were examined in there.The apoptotic cells were often seen in the collecting ducts.With TUNEL staining,the different stage apoptotic cells were examined with corresponding patho-morphologic changes.The early apoptotic cell had a pyknosis with thick nuclear membran and uniform staining.The final one had a smalll nuclei,a little cytoplasm and wrinkle menbrane.The small pyknosis was closely surrounded by wrinkle membrane.Finally,the typical apoptotic body was formed by injury cells.With P~(53) and Bcl-2 staining,the nuclei and cytoplasm of injury cells were stained because of the diffuse of gene products.The results evidenced that TUNEL staining is a sensitive and reliable method for examining apoptotic cells caused by encephalitozoon cuniculi.P~(53) and Bcl-2 genes seemed to be taken part to the process of renal cell apoptosis.The polyuria and dehydration of ill rabbits in clinic were related to renal epithelium apoptosis of distal convoluted renal tubule and collecting duct.
